LOUISVILLE, Ky. (WDRB) -- With just 100 days to go until the 150th running of the Kentucky Derby, submissions are now open for this year's Survivors Parade at the Kentucky Oaks.

The parade is happening Friday, May 3, at Churchill Downs. This will be the 16th year for the annual parade.

Those who have overcome, or are currently battling, a breast or ovarian cancer diagnosis and have never participated in the parade are invited to send in their story. 

Once the submission period is over, 150 people will be chosen at random to take part in the annual parade. 

Selected participants will also get two tickets to the 150th Kentucky Oaks.

The deadline to submit is Tuesday, Feb. 20. Winners will be announced Monday, Feb. 26.
